What is the maximum slope allowed for the launch site?

Explanation:
The maximum slope allowed for the launch site is 10 degrees because this limitation is set to ensure the safety and effectiveness of the launch operations. A slope that exceeds 10 degrees could potentially compromise the stability of the launching platform and affect the trajectory of the projectile, leading to inconsistent results or dangerous situations. The 10-degree threshold balances operational flexibility with the necessary precautions to maintain safety protocols and optimal firing conditions. This standard is derived from empirical data and best practices to minimize risks associated with uneven terrain during launches.
